内容:
在进行离线重组(Reorg)操作时,许多用户都会关心所需的空间大小。以下是一些常见的问题及解答,帮助您更好地理解并优化存储资源。
问题一:离线重组操作通常需要多少空间?
离线重组操作所需的空间取决于多个因素,包括数据量、数据结构和存储介质。一般来说,以下是一些常见情况:
数据量:如果您的数据量较大,例如包含数百万条记录的大型数据库,那么离线重组所需的空间可能会达到数十GB甚至更多。
数据结构:数据结构复杂或包含大量嵌套关系的数据,可能需要更多的空间进行重组。
存储介质:使用SSD(固态硬盘)通常比使用HDD(机械硬盘)需要更多的空间,因为SSD的读写速度更快,但容量相对较小。
问题二:如何估算离线重组所需的空间大小?
要估算离线重组所需的空间大小,您可以采取以下步骤:
1. 分析数据量:统计数据库中所有表的数据量,包括行数和字段大小。
2. 考虑索引和触发器:索引和触发器也会占用一定空间,因此需要将它们的大小也纳入考虑。
3. 预留额外空间:为了应对可能的意外情况,建议预留10%至20%的额外空间。
问题三:如何优化离线重组操作的空间使用?
为了优化离线重组操作的空间使用,您可以采取以下措施:
压缩数据:在重组前对数据进行压缩,可以减少所需的空间。
分区存储:将数据分区存储,可以降低单个数据集的大小,从而减少空间需求。
使用更高效的存储介质:升级到SSD等更高效的存储介质,可以提高读写速度,降低空间占用。
通过以上问题和解答,相信您对离线重组操作所需的空间有了更深入的了解。在实际操作中,根据具体情况调整策略,以优化存储资源。